Credit Policy

What is the primary distinction between monetary policy and credit policy?
Monetary policy addresses the overall money supply and price level at a macro level, while credit policy focuses on the direction, cost, and availability of bank credit to specific sectors of the economy.
What is the correct description of credit policy's scope in the economy?
It covers cost and availability of bank credit to specific sectors.
Which institution is responsible for administering credit policy in India?
The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) administers credit policy, not the Finance Ministry.
How is credit policy described in relation to monetary policy?
Credit policy is an adjunct or supplement to monetary policy.
